Context of the Maritime Chokepoint

The Strait of Hormuz, located between Oman and Iran, serves as the primary gateway for oil exports from Saudi Arabia, Iraq, the United Arab Emirates, and Kuwait. Any disruption to this narrow passage forces tankers to seek alternative, often more expensive and time-consuming routes, impacting global logistics.

Historically, the region has been a focal point for international tension. The current decline in transit volume reflects a broader pattern of escalation in regional security concerns, as commercial vessels increasingly avoid the area to mitigate risks associated with potential seizure or military posturing.

Energy Market Volatility and Economic Impact

Daniel Yergin, vice chairman of S&P Global, notes that the uncertainty surrounding the strait acts as a psychological weight on global commodity markets. Even in the absence of a total closure, the threat of restricted access creates a risk premium that drives up fuel costs for consumers worldwide.

Data from the International Energy Agency indicates that if the current reduction in traffic persists, the global economy could face significant inflationary pressures. As refining margins tighten and shipping insurance premiums rise, the cost of transporting crude oil from the Persian Gulf to international hubs increases, ultimately impacting the price of gasoline and heating oil at the retail level.

Expert Perspectives on Supply Chain Resilience

Industry experts emphasize that while global supply chains have become more resilient since the 1970s, the concentration of energy transit through a single point remains a structural vulnerability. Yergin highlights that the world is currently in a transition phase where energy security is being redefined by both physical infrastructure and geopolitical alliances.

Diversification of pipelines and increased production from non-OPEC nations provide some cushion against localized maritime disruptions. However, the sheer volume of hydrocarbons moving through the Strait of Hormuz means that no combination of alternative infrastructure can fully compensate for a sustained, large-scale blockage.

Implications for Future Energy Security

The persistence of these tensions suggests that energy independence will likely remain a central pillar of national security policy for major economies. Moving forward, observers should watch for shifts in maritime security operations led by international coalitions aimed at ensuring freedom of navigation through the strait.

Furthermore, analysts are monitoring how these risks influence investment patterns in renewable energy projects. As geopolitical instability underscores the fragility of fossil fuel supply chains, the push for localized energy production may accelerate, fundamentally altering the global reliance on centralized maritime chokepoints in the coming decade.
